One-sentence summary
This book gives an overview of the Bible from Genesis to Revelation in a comic book style format.
Description
Good and Evil by Michael Pearl is a 312-page soft cover book 7” x 10¼”. It contains comic book style pictures with bubble captions of Bible stories from Genesis to Revelation. (The artist, Danny Bulanadi, formerly worked for Marvel Comics.) It is not Scripture except in some quotations. At present the pictures are in black and white, but color pictures are planned for the future. The text has been translated into 11 other languages with many more translations planned for the future. The books can be printed overseas for less than one US dollar. No Greater Joy Ministries (NGJ) claims that the book can be translated (by professional translators), formatted, and printed in three months. It is designed to appeal to children and all who like comic books.
Considerations
Comic books are popular around the world where people have access to them. For this reason many missions working in cities may want to promote the use of this book as it becomes available in national languages. Before promoting this book in rural areas in non-western societies, it would be good to test the comic book format to be sure the words and pictures are understood without any or with only minimal instruction. The pictures are well done and interesting. Some sample pictures should be tested before attempting the project in a rural non-western society.
Limitations
Because the text in the bubbles is not a translation of Scripture, the Bible story narrations and quotations are subject to human interpretation. Most pages do have one or more biblical references listed at the bottom of each page, which is helpful for checking the accuracy of the Bible story. There are some direct quotes from Scripture in which the King James Version is used. A translator would want to read the text very thoroughly, looking for any discrepancies with Scripture before deciding whether or not to take on the project. It is not known if NGJ would accept changes in the text. The pictures/images are also subject to interpretation. On the first page in the Creation story God is represented as a three-part star of light. The words “a perfect trinity of love” are written beside it. On the third page, where Adam is being formed from the dust, three pairs of eyes watch from the black background. There is no explanation as to who the eyes represent. On the next page a pair of eyes in the dark has the caption “Satan, the evil one watched.” The next picture contains a quote from God and a flaming hand pointing to the tree of the knowledge of good and evil. These pictures should be tested with some people from the intended audience to see how they are understood. From the translator’s point of view there may be many pictures that are questionable in that regard.
